
Broadcasting on 67kHz of 88.5 FM -- Los Angeles The
mission of LARRS is to ensure that those who are print impaired have the same access to
information as those who can read text.
The Los Angeles Radio Reading Service is a project of Community Partners, a nonprofit
corporation. It is coordinated by two people who are blind for those who are blind:
